Colossians 1: 13 -18
For He has rescued us and has
drawn us to Himself from the dominion of darkness, and has transferred us to
the kingdom of His Beloved Son, in whom we have redemption because
of His sacrifice, resulting in the forgiveness of our sins and the cancellation
of sins’ penalty.
The Son is the image of
the invisible God, the firstborn over all creation. For in him
all things were created: things in heaven and on earth, visible and
invisible, whether thrones or powers or rulers or authorities; all things
have been created through him and for him. He is before all things; in
him all things hold together. And he is the head of the body, the
church; he is the beginning and the firstborn from among the dead, so
that in everything he might have the supremacy.
